Strange. As I see in their dialogs (ALTOS.dlg and RESAR.dlg), there are the following options:

1) You completed their sidequests, and Narlen just stabs Resar in a cutscene, everyone happy. This seems to be the only outcome depending on Narlen sidequests.

2) Resar becomes hostile, you kill Resar, Altos apologizes (which means you should be able to talk to him):

"So you've killed the Halruaan. Well, don't take it personally that I let him attack you; he was a powerful mage, and there was little I could do to dissuade him from killing you. Don't worry, you have full run of the guild—if you're able to kill a Halruaan mage, I'm sure there's little that my guild members can do to you. Again, accept my apologies for the entire incident."

In my case the second option only happens if I Ctrl-Y Resar immediately when he becomes hostile (when the game autopauses) and then the "hostility" doesn't spread through the building. 

 

EDIT: I've just tested this in a clean BGEE installation and this works properly. Created new char, teleported to AR0153, talked to Altos, added the 3 items (MISC69, 70, 71), talked to Altos again, Resar attacks, all other NPCs do not become hostile. Resar is killed, talk to Altos, he apologizes that "there was little I could do"

So some mod is breaking that in my installation.

This is an interesting tradeoff between tactics and aesthetics. Tactically, you’re absolutely right that every wizard should have Stoneskin precast immediately, but aesthetically it means that every wizard - even ones who are non hostile and mostly just want to talk - is grey, which is ugly. 

At one point, I Stoneskinned red-circled mages in advance as a compromise. I honestly can’t recall if I’m still doing that - I think it might have been lost in the v32 rewrite. Will check when I have a chance.

So far as I know, you can’t disable it in EE. (If that’s out of date, I’d be interested in the details.)

EEex allows to recreate Stone Skins with all kinds of customization (no or different visual effects, effects triggered when a layer is consumed, effects triggered when all layers are gone), the latest version has example spells in the rep.  

(You could even create a custom invisible stone skin with 1 layer that triggers the real 'pre-buff' stone skin effect if it is consumed) 

Of course that would require EEex but I think its going to be as popular as ToBEx or more so anyway once EET and IWD-in-EET require it.
